Brazil welcomes International students to study in their country and all public Universities are tuition free even for foreigners. Brazil is also trying to encourage International students to come and study here in Brazil, hence they have set up GCUB which is a body that provides funding (grants) to international students who intend to study in Brazil. The funding is a monthly stipend provided to support students while studying. Without it, you can still study for free.

Admission Process
Each faculty decides their own admission process so if you’re interested in a particular course, you’ll need to check the faculty website to see when they usually start their admission process as well as requirements. Some faculties require entrance exams, some don’t. If they do, you’ll make arrangements to write the exam in Nigeria.


Language
Brazil universities are one of the best in the world. Learning language is Portuguese but as an international student, you can request to do your work in English. Depending on your faculty requirements, you may need to write Portuguese proficiency exam or complete a Portuguese course within one year of admission.
Most of the Universities website have the option to view their website in English language at the top of the website. If not you can use your browser’s translation tool to translate the website.

After Gaining Admission
You’ll need to authenticate your documents at the Ministry of foreign affairs and Ministry of Education. You’ll also legalize with the Brazilian embassy in Lagos.
You’ll then apply for your study visa. If you have a study grant, you may not need to prove financially capability, otherwise you’ll need to.

What if you don’t get a grant?

What happens if you don’t get a grant? You can still attend the university for FREE and look for side hustles. I advise you learn some digital skills before leaving naija.

Remote Jobs
You can get remote jobs from the US or Canada. Common remote jobs are Customer care jobs, Tech Jobs etc. Do a thorough research and learn a useful skill before coming.

Driving Uber.
You can drive Uber Part time. You won’t necessarily have to buy a car, there are care rentals specifically for Uber here. You’ll need to convert your driver’s license from Nigeria in order to this. This is a good one because you don’t necessarily have to speak to your riders so no language issues.

Teaching English Language.

There are lots of English teaching jobs which can be done online from your house.

LANGUAGE BARRIER.

Only 5% of Brazilians speak English. Good news is you’ll be in the university environment where most of the 5% are. You can also request to do your work in English. That said, it would be better for you to learn Portuguese. There are so many language schools, both public and private where you can learn Portuguese. You’ll also make Brazilian friends who will help you practice

What you can do to learn on your own.

Use Language Apps like Duolingo and Drop
Watch Brazilian movies; You’ll find them on Netflix.
Listen to Brazilian Music

Brazilian consulate is accepting visa applications not in person or by booking an appointment. You can send your complete visa application through courier in Lagos and include your printout of evidence of payment for your visa fees.

Steps to Applying for an Admission.

Find a School.

I provided links to schools above, these are schools in the state of São Paulo. There are schools in other states in Brazil as well. You can do research about schools in Rio de Janeiro, Bahia, Rio Grade de Sul etc.
Bahia has good concentration of black people so you may feel more at home there.
Use your browser’s translation tool to translate websites.


Find a Course.
Once you find a school, check if they offer your program of choice. You need to find their Selection Process, It’s usually (not always) in PDF format. Download and translate with the tool provided above.
Brazilian Universities usually leave little time for application (1-3 weeks). They expect you to have been prepared ahead of time. If the program you are interested in has closed for the year, check the requirements still and get everything ready. Keep checking their website for the next Selection process notice. If you have any need for clarification , email the program office and they will respond.
Some courses may require you to reach out to professors in the faculty to supervise you.

If you failed to apply for GCUB scholarship for the year, you may still apply directly to the faculty for scholarship and if not so competitive, you may get it.


After you apply and gain admission.

The school will spell out the necessary steps but from Nigeria, you’ll need to authenticate and legalize your documents.

Applying for Visa.
Visa Application Process is quite simple, similar to the tourist application process.
Documents you’ll typically need are.

Educational Documents
Admissions Offer Letter/Introduction Letter from School
Self Introduction Letter
Scholarship Offer Letter/Bank Statement
International passport
Covid vaccination certificate
Birth certificate
Bank reference letter
Visa Application Form
Colored Passport Photo on White Background
Flight Reservation

Visa Approved Congratulations, What next?
Check School requirements for things you need to do.
Research Accommodation
Join Expat groups on Facebook to see other foreigners experiences
Book hotel for a few days to help you give you time to get accommodation
Book flight to your destination

Thank you for your information. Please what about health insurance. How may months is required

You’re welcome.

Health insurance is not a requirement. You have access to free healthcare.
